Short-Term Hashes
First Claim
Patent Images
1. A method comprising:
- by one or more computing devices, receiving a search query;
by one or more computing devices, determining one or more search terms based on the received search query, each search term comprising a prefix and a suffix;
by one or more computing devices, for each of the search terms;
generating a first binary number based on the each search term'"'"'s prefix and suffix; and
accessing and retrieving one or more search results of the each search term from one or more data stores by hashing the first binary number; and
by one or more computing device, aggregating search results of the respective search terms.
2 Assignments
0 Petitions
Accused Products
Abstract
In one embodiment, a server receives a search query; the server determines search terms based on the received search query, each search term including a prefix and a suffix; for each of the search term, the server generates a first binary number based on the each search term'"'"'s prefix and suffix, and accesses and retrieves search results of the each search term from data stores by hashing the first binary number; the server also aggregates search results of the respective search terms.
8 Citations
18 Claims
-
1. A method comprising:
-
by one or more computing devices, receiving a search query; by one or more computing devices, determining one or more search terms based on the received search query, each search term comprising a prefix and a suffix; by one or more computing devices, for each of the search terms; generating a first binary number based on the each search term'"'"'s prefix and suffix; and accessing and retrieving one or more search results of the each search term from one or more data stores by hashing the first binary number; and by one or more computing device, aggregating search results of the respective search terms.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. One or more computer-readable non-transitory storage media embodying software that is operable when executed to:
-
receive a search query; determine one or more search terms based on the received search query, each search term comprising a prefix and a suffix; for each of the search terms; generate a first binary number based on the each search term'"'"'s prefix and suffix; and access and retrieve one or more search results of the each search term from one or more data stores by hashing the first binary number; and aggregate search results of the respective search terms. - View Dependent Claims (8, 9, 10, 11, 12)
-
-
13. A system comprising:
-
one or more processors; and a memory coupled to the processors comprising instructions executable by the processors, the processors being operable when executing the instructions to; receive a search query; determine one or more search terms based on the received search query, each search term comprising a prefix and a suffix; for each of the search terms; generate a first binary number based on the each search term'"'"'s prefix and suffix; and access and retrieve one or more search results of the each search term from one or more data stores by hashing the first binary number; and aggregate search results of the respective search terms. - View Dependent Claims (14, 15, 16, 17, 18)
-
Specification